Home
last modified time | relevance | path

Searched refs:pr_usrreqs (Results 1 – 25 of 46) sorted by relevance

12

/f-stack/freebsd/netinet/
H A Din_proto.c107 .pr_usrreqs = &nousrreqs \
118 .pr_usrreqs = &nousrreqs
129 .pr_usrreqs = &udp_usrreqs
142 .pr_usrreqs = &tcp_usrreqs
178 .pr_usrreqs = &udp_usrreqs
188 .pr_usrreqs = &rip_usrreqs
197 .pr_usrreqs = &rip_usrreqs
208 .pr_usrreqs = &rip_usrreqs
217 .pr_usrreqs = &rip_usrreqs
226 .pr_usrreqs = &rip_usrreqs
[all …]
H A Dsctp_module.c67 .pr_usrreqs = &sctp_usrreqs,
79 .pr_usrreqs = &sctp_usrreqs,
96 .pr_usrreqs = &sctp6_usrreqs,
111 .pr_usrreqs = &sctp6_usrreqs,
H A Dudp_var.h138 extern struct pr_usrreqs udp_usrreqs;
H A Dip_var.h196 extern struct pr_usrreqs rip_usrreqs;
/f-stack/freebsd/netgraph/bluetooth/socket/
H A Dng_btsocket.c71 static struct pr_usrreqs ng_btsocket_hci_raw_usrreqs = {
90 static struct pr_usrreqs ng_btsocket_l2cap_raw_usrreqs = {
109 static struct pr_usrreqs ng_btsocket_l2cap_usrreqs = {
130 static struct pr_usrreqs ng_btsocket_rfcomm_usrreqs = {
151 static struct pr_usrreqs ng_btsocket_sco_usrreqs = {
180 .pr_usrreqs = &ng_btsocket_hci_raw_usrreqs,
188 .pr_usrreqs = &ng_btsocket_l2cap_raw_usrreqs,
197 .pr_usrreqs = &ng_btsocket_l2cap_usrreqs,
206 .pr_usrreqs = &ng_btsocket_rfcomm_usrreqs,
215 .pr_usrreqs = &ng_btsocket_sco_usrreqs,
/f-stack/freebsd/netinet6/
H A Din6_proto.c140 .pr_usrreqs = &nousrreqs \
151 .pr_usrreqs = &nousrreqs,
233 .pr_usrreqs = &rip6_usrreqs
246 .pr_usrreqs = &rip6_usrreqs
254 .pr_usrreqs = &nousrreqs
262 .pr_usrreqs = &nousrreqs
270 .pr_usrreqs = &nousrreqs
281 .pr_usrreqs = &rip6_usrreqs
292 .pr_usrreqs = &rip6_usrreqs
302 .pr_usrreqs = &rip6_usrreqs
[all …]
H A Dudp6_var.h71 extern struct pr_usrreqs udp6_usrreqs;
H A Dtcp6_var.h80 extern struct pr_usrreqs tcp6_usrreqs;
H A Dsctp6_var.h44 extern struct pr_usrreqs sctp6_usrreqs;
H A Dip6protosw.h83 struct pr_usrreqs;
H A Dudp6_usrreq.c781 struct pr_usrreqs *pru; in udp6_output()
794 pru = inetsw[ip_protox[nxt]].pr_usrreqs; in udp6_output()
1012 struct pr_usrreqs *pru; in udp6_abort()
1018 pru = inetsw[ip_protox[nxt]].pr_usrreqs; in udp6_abort()
1144 struct pr_usrreqs *pru; in udp6_close()
1150 pru = inetsw[ip_protox[nxt]].pr_usrreqs; in udp6_close()
1295 struct pr_usrreqs *pru; in udp6_disconnect()
1301 pru = inetsw[ip_protox[nxt]].pr_usrreqs; in udp6_disconnect()
1349 struct pr_usrreqs udp6_usrreqs = {
H A Dsend.c305 struct pr_usrreqs send_usrreqs = {
314 .pr_usrreqs = &send_usrreqs
/f-stack/freebsd/kern/
H A Duipc_domain.c86 struct pr_usrreqs nousrreqs = {
110 struct pr_usrreqs *pu; in protosw_init()
112 pu = pr->pr_usrreqs; in protosw_init()
345 if (npr->pr_usrreqs == NULL) in pf_proto_register()
457 dpr->pr_usrreqs = &nousrreqs; in pf_proto_unregister()
H A Duipc_socket.c527 if (prp->pr_usrreqs->pru_attach == NULL || in socreate()
1141 if (pr->pr_usrreqs->pru_detach != NULL)
1142 (*pr->pr_usrreqs->pru_detach)(so);
1214 (*so->so_proto->pr_usrreqs->pru_close)(so);
1285 (*so->so_proto->pr_usrreqs->pru_abort)(so);
1935 (*pr->pr_usrreqs->pru_rcvd)(so, 0);
2317 (*pr->pr_usrreqs->pru_rcvd)(so, flags);
2370 (*pr->pr_usrreqs->pru_rcvd)(so, flags);
2851 if (pr->pr_usrreqs->pru_flush != NULL)
2852 (*pr->pr_usrreqs->pru_flush)(so, how);
[all …]
H A Dsys_socket.c282 error = ((*so->so_proto->pr_usrreqs->pru_control) in soo_ioctl()
343 error = so->so_proto->pr_usrreqs->pru_sense(so, ub); in soo_stat()
420 error = so->so_proto->pr_usrreqs->pru_sockaddr(so, &sa); in soo_fill_kinfo()
426 error = so->so_proto->pr_usrreqs->pru_peeraddr(so, &sa); in soo_fill_kinfo()
812 error = (*so->so_proto->pr_usrreqs->pru_aio_queue)(so, job); in soo_aio_queue()
H A Dkern_sendfile.c380 so->so_proto->pr_usrreqs->pru_abort(so); in sendfile_iodone()
399 (void)(so->so_proto->pr_usrreqs->pru_ready)(so, sfio->m, in sendfile_iodone()
1176 error = (*so->so_proto->pr_usrreqs->pru_send) in vn_sendfile()
1182 error = (*so->so_proto->pr_usrreqs->pru_send) in vn_sendfile()
1188 error = (*so->so_proto->pr_usrreqs->pru_send) in vn_sendfile()
/f-stack/tools/compat/include/sys/
H A Dprotosw.h93 struct pr_usrreqs *pr_usrreqs; /* user-protocol hook */ member
186 struct pr_usrreqs { struct
/f-stack/freebsd/sys/
H A Dprotosw.h95 struct pr_usrreqs *pr_usrreqs; /* user-protocol hook */ member
188 struct pr_usrreqs { struct
/f-stack/freebsd/net/
H A Draw_cb.h88 extern struct pr_usrreqs raw_usrreqs;
H A Draw_usrreq.c265 struct pr_usrreqs raw_usrreqs = {
/f-stack/freebsd/netipsec/
H A Dkeysock.c419 struct pr_usrreqs key_usrreqs = {
452 .pr_usrreqs = &key_usrreqs
/f-stack/tools/compat/include/netinet/
H A Dudp_var.h138 extern struct pr_usrreqs udp_usrreqs;
H A Dip_var.h196 extern struct pr_usrreqs rip_usrreqs;
/f-stack/freebsd/netgraph/
H A Dng_socket.c1131 static struct pr_usrreqs ngc_usrreqs = {
1145 static struct pr_usrreqs ngd_usrreqs = {
1171 .pr_usrreqs = &ngc_usrreqs
1178 .pr_usrreqs = &ngd_usrreqs
/f-stack/freebsd/security/mac/
H A Dmac_socket.c519 if (so->so_proto->pr_usrreqs->pru_sosetlabel != NULL) in mac_socket_label_set()
520 (so->so_proto->pr_usrreqs->pru_sosetlabel)(so); in mac_socket_label_set()

12